Japanese Voyeurs have pulled out of a scheduled appearance at tonight’s Clash Presents due to illness.
The band were planning to perform with Bones and Whales In Cubicles at the Lexington but have had to cancel due to problems with the singer’s voice.
Those planning on attending the event are still welcome to but will also be compensated with free guestlist for the next Clash Presents.
On their official Facebook page, Clash wrote: ‘Unfortunately Japanese Voyeurs have had to pull out of tonight’s show as Romily, their singer, has completely lost her voice… We’ll still be partying though so come on down and enjoy Bones and Whales In Cubicles, as well as Club.The.Mammoth. and Clash Djs.
Anyone who has bought an advance ticket is still of course welcome! But we’ll sort you all guestlist entry for the next launch on 6th October to make up for it.’
